Maughold 
1851 
18
The humble petition of William Hampton of the parish of Maughold. Sheweth:
That Matthias Hampton your petitioneršs brother departed this life in the
month of May1850 intestate leaving your petitioner his only surviving
brother him surviving and leaving no other next of kindred but your
petitioner and Jane Hampton widow deceadents mother entitled to
his personal estate.
That it is expedient that your petitioner or some other fit and  proper
person should be appointed administrator of the estate of the said Matthias
Hampton.
Wherefore your petitioner prays a hearing hereof and that your worship may
be pleased to appoint your petitioner administrator of the estate of the
said  Matthias Hampton and he will pray.
                                F. J. D. LaMothe for the petitioner.
								
Ordered that this petition do come on to be heard at a court to be holden at
Ramsey on Friday next the 25th instant whereof all proper parties are to
have due notice.
Given this 22nd day of April 1851         T. A. Corlett

At an Eccl Court held in Ramsey the 25th April 1851
William Hampton and Jane Hampton sworn administrators of his estate.
